April is the month of the Military Child
Not only is April Child Abuse Prevention Month, it is also the Month of the Military Child. This month highlight’s the important role military children play in the Armed Forces community.
Over at the Naval Construction Battalion Center in Gulfport, also known as the Seabee Base, there’s a variety of support programs that help year-round.
There’s the Family Advocacy Program which is an intervention and prevention program for child abuse and neglect.
There’s also a support program for new parents in which home visitors, COVID permitting, can help prepare and educate families who are expecting. NCBC Therapist Dr. Jamie Williams said, “It can be difficult. Parenting is a tough job, in addition to being a full-time working parent or a full time at home parent. So, these programs are really meant to prevent, as well as to intervene if something does happen. It works as an intervention process.”
